When your travels start to get in the way again buy yourself some elastic bands and throw them in your suit case to work out in your hotel room. Sticking to the schedule and taking the time to do what you might consider to be a low level workout is better than doing nothing at all. It's about making doing some form of exercise so much part of your routine that you don't even think about it you just do it.
